1. Best for Itchy Skin: DOUXO® S3 PYO Combo Set (Shampoo + Mousse)

Is your pup scratching like there’s no tomorrow? Stop the itch before it starts.

If your dog suffers from chronic itchiness, red skin, or signs of infection, DOUXO® S3 PYO is the gold standard. This veterinary-recommended set includes both the shampoo and mousse to deliver powerful, medicated relief without harsh chemicals.

  • Key Ingredients: Ophytrium (a purified natural ingredient for skin barrier protection), Chlorhexidine (antimicrobial)
  • Texture: Rich lather, paired with a lightweight mousse for leave-on care
  • Free from: Soaps, sulfates, parabens, and nano particles
  • Effectiveness: Clinically proven to reduce inflammation, bacterial and fungal skin overgrowth

Use the mousse between washes for ongoing relief, especially on hotspots or paws. It’s gentle enough for regular use but strong enough for serious skin issues.

5. Best for Dermatitis: Veterinary Formula Clinical Care

Red, scaly, greasy skin? Dermatitis doesn’t stand a chance.

This Veterinary Formula shampoo is formulated to tackle tough skin conditions like seborrhea, bacterial infections, and fungal overgrowths. It offers real relief for pets who suffer from chronic skin issues.

  • Key Ingredients: Benzethonium chloride (antibacterial), ketoconazole (antifungal), aloe vera
  • Fast-acting: Shows improvement in skin texture and redness after just a few uses
  • Soap-free and pH balanced: Gentle on irritated skin
  • Affordable treatment alternative to prescription shampoos

For dogs with chronic skin problems, this shampoo is a game-changer. Pair with a vet-recommended treatment plan for best results.
